Efficient neutron radiation shielding by boron-lithium imidazolate frameworks.

Zhenyu LiYue HanAosong WangDong ZhaoLongfei FanLinwei HeShuya ZhangPeng ChengHanzhou LiuZhifang ChaiShu-Ao Wang
Published in: Dalton transactions (Cambridge, England : 2003) (2022)
Radiation protective materials are widely applied to avoid occupational hazards from either particle emissions or high-energy electromagnetic waves. Herein, we present a boron imidazolate framework (BIF) as a novel neutron shielding additive with high neutron capture cross-section elements B/Li and H. The BIF1-based epoxy resin matrix (Ep-BIF1) possesses high thermal stability and excellent resistance capacity. The neutron radiation shielding property was characterized using an Am-Be source, in which the thermal neutron shielding efficiency of Ep-BIF1 is notably higher than that of Ep-B 4 C with equal boron concentration, showing potential applications as an advanced efficient neutron radiation shielding composite.
